This study evaluate the cognitive functions of patient after hip or kneel replacement.Half of the patient will receive transcutaneous vagus nerve electrical stimulation during the surgery while the other half will get placebo therapy

Inclusion criteria

  • over 65 years old
  • ability to communication
  • hip or kneel replacement
  • willing to participate in the study
  • ASA I-II

Exclusion criteria

  • with cerebral disorders or disease
  • cognitive impairment before surgery
  • with mental disease
  • unable to communication
  • severe eyes or ears impairment
  • surgery performed in the past 30 days
  • Bradycardia,II°AVB,III°AVB,severe heart, liver and kidney dysfunction
  • severe skin disease
  • refuse to enter the study
